    ...In addition and considering the mention "...nces Pier" on the tag...


    ...So, It's at least from the 1920's as te Prince's Pier harbour was from this period...
    "Princes Pier is a 580 metre long historic pier on Port Phillip, in Port Melbourne, Victoria, Australia. It was known as the New Railway Pier until renamed Prince's Pier after the Prince of Wales (later Edward VIII) who visited Melbourne in May 1920"
